  • Trinity Crescent, located in the Trinity district of Edinburgh, approximately two miles north of the city centre, is a high amenity area with a thriving community. Trinity comprises a range of high quality, traditional homes that are desirable and popular with families.
  • With active churches, tennis and bowling clubs, private parks and a wide selection of specialist shops and major supermarkets, the district is its own haven. There are plentiful pubs, cafes and restaurants, in addition to those in the neighbouring areas of Inverleith and Leith.
  • Nearby amenities include the picturesque Newhaven harbour, Ocean Terminal shopping centre and Leith Shore. Sports facilities include sailing at Granton and the David Lloyd Leisure Centre at Western Harbour.
  • The area is particularly well served by schools with a choice of nurseries, the newly completed Victoria Primary School and Trinity Academy as well as the Edinburgh Academy, Fettes College, Erskine Stewart's Melville Schools and St George's.
  • Trinity has good public transport links with a number of bus services providing direct route to the city centre. The Edinburgh Tram extension, due for completion June 2023, terminates at Newhaven, within 10 minutes walk. There is also an extensive network of cycle paths and convenient road access westwards to the City Bypass, Edinburgh Business Park, Edinburgh Airport and beyond to the Central Scotland Motorway Network.
